Top 5 Miner Games in the US: Q2 2024 Performance Analysis

In Q2 2024, the top 5 miner games in the United States showed varying trends in downloads, revenue, and weekly active users. Here is a detailed look at their performance:

Gold and Goblins: Idle Games from AppQuantum Publishing Ltd experienced a fluctuating revenue pattern, starting the quarter at around $537K and ending at approximately $431K. Downloads saw significant growth, peaking at 104K in mid-June, and weekly active users grew steadily from 101K to around 166K by the end of the quarter.

Diggy's Adventure: Pipe Games from Pixel Federation Games had a stable revenue stream, with a notable peak of $117K in early May. Downloads remained relatively low, peaking at 1.8K in the last week of June, while weekly active users showed a slight decline from 33.4K to about 30.2K.

Idle Miner Tycoon: Money Games by Kolibri Games GmbH maintained a consistent revenue, with a peak of $75.6K in late May. Downloads varied, reaching a high of 40.9K in late May, and weekly active users fluctuated, ending the quarter at around 430K.

Miners Settlement: Idle RPG from Funventure P S A had modest revenue figures, peaking at $6.3K in mid-June. Downloads were generally low, with the highest being 4.1K in late April. Weekly active users showed a declining trend, ending at around 5.7K.

TAP! DIG! MY MUSEUM! by takuya ori showed stable revenue, averaging around $2K throughout the quarter. Downloads peaked at 5.3K in late April, while weekly active users remained steady, averaging around 12K.
